Using Operator Assistance

This procedure describes how to measure either a circle or slot feature using the Operator Assistance option. Operator assistance is usually used to prevent the possibility of crashing the CMM when it tries to measure a hole or slot that is fairly small in comparison to the stylus tip diameter, especially in a process which is not very precise, such as sheet metal or plastic parts
  1. Select the parent process or preceding activity for the measure circle activity. 

  2. On the Inspection Activities toolbar, select the Measure Circle or Measure Slot icon.

  3. Select the defined circle or slot you wish to measure.

  4. Either the Define Circle or Define Slot dialog box appears.

  5. Click on the More button.

    The Secure Box and Operator Assistance options appear.
  6. Enter the information as needed and check the Operator Assistance box; then click on the OK button.

The consequence of checking this box is to create additional DMIS statements.  At at runtime on the CMM, these statements have the following effects:
  1. Put the CMM in manual mode (joystick drive)

  2. Prompt the user to drive the probe tip into the CENTER of the hole or slot that is near the probe

  3. Require the user to then hit "continue" key on the OIT (Operator Interface Terminal) of the CMM

  4. CMM will then switch back to CNC mode and begin measuring the hole or slot using the current center of the tip as a "nominal" center of the feature.
